VirtualBox

Ignore:
Timestamp:
Aug 3, 2022 8:15:46 PM (3 years ago)
Author:
vboxsync
Message:

VMM/IEM: Implement [v]pmaxs{b,w,d} instructions, bugref:9898

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/src/VBox/VMM/VMMAll/IEMAllInstructionsVexMap2.cpp.h

    r96007 r96010  
    418418
    419419/** Opcode VEX.66.0F38 0x3c. */
    420 FNIEMOP_STUB(iemOp_vpmaxsb_Vx_Hx_Wx);
     420FNIEMOP_DEF(iemOp_vpmaxsb_Vx_Hx_Wx)
     421{
     422    IEMOP_MNEMONIC3(VEX_RVM, VPMAXSB, vpmaxsb, Vx, Hx, Wx, DISOPTYPE_HARMLESS, 0);
     423    IEMOPMEDIAF3_INIT_VARS(vpmaxsb);
     424    return FNIEMOP_CALL_1(iemOpCommonAvxAvx2_Vx_Hx_Wx, IEM_SELECT_HOST_OR_FALLBACK(fAvx2, &s_Host, &s_Fallback));
     425}
     426
     427
    421428/** Opcode VEX.66.0F38 0x3d. */
    422 FNIEMOP_STUB(iemOp_vpmaxsd_Vx_Hx_Wx);
     429FNIEMOP_DEF(iemOp_vpmaxsd_Vx_Hx_Wx)
     430{
     431    IEMOP_MNEMONIC3(VEX_RVM, VPMAXSD, vpmaxsd, Vx, Hx, Wx, DISOPTYPE_HARMLESS, 0);
     432    IEMOPMEDIAF3_INIT_VARS(vpmaxsd);
     433    return FNIEMOP_CALL_1(iemOpCommonAvxAvx2_Vx_Hx_Wx, IEM_SELECT_HOST_OR_FALLBACK(fAvx2, &s_Host, &s_Fallback));
     434}
    423435
    424436
Note: See TracChangeset for help on using the changeset viewer.

© 2024 Oracle Support Privacy / Do Not Sell My Info Terms of Use Trademark Policy Automated Access Etiquette